
How to Properly Enable Secure Boot for Enhanced System Security in 2025
In an age where cybersecurity threats are growing increasingly sophisticated, ensuring your system’s integrity is paramount. One effective way to bolster your system's security is by enabling Secure Boot. This firmware feature helps prevent unauthorized software from loading during the boot process, creating a trusted environment for your operating system. Particularly in 2025, with the increasing reliance on digital platforms, understanding how to enable Secure Boot is essential for both individual users and businesses alike.
This article will provide a comprehensive guide on enabling Secure Boot, covering everything from initial configurations in the BIOS/UEFI settings to troubleshooting common issues. We will explore Secure Boot's importance, advantages, and setups for various operating systems including Windows 10, Windows 11, and Linux. By following the secure boot instructions provided, you will ensure the safety of your data and the proper functioning of your applications.
By the end of this guide, you'll be equipped with the knowledge to enable Secure Boot, configure settings, and understand the implications of this feature on your system's overall security. Let’s delve into the essential steps and considerations involved in enabling Secure Boot.

Understanding Secure Boot and Its Importance
Before jumping into the technical aspects of enabling Secure Boot, it's crucial to understand what Secure Boot is and why it's essential. Secure Boot is a security standard that ensures that a computer's software is trusted and verified before allowing it to run. Its core role is to protect the system against boot-level attacks that can install malware or other malicious software.
Benefits of Secure Boot
Enabling Secure Boot presents numerous benefits, notably enhancing your system’s security against unauthorized accesses and software that isn’t signed. This means that only operating systems and drivers that have been certified will be allowed to boot. Moreover, Secure Boot assists in maintaining system integrity and improving overall system performance by preventing potential malicious code from being executed during startup.
Secure Boot vs. Legacy Boot
Trusting in traditional Legacy Boot methods can leave systems vulnerable to various attacks. Secure Boot, in contrast, operates within the UEFI firmware environment, improving security by adding a layer of authentication. Users can expect far more robust protection with Secure Boot especially as they integrate complex software systems in their environments. Understanding these distinctions helps in clearer decision-making regarding system preferences and security configurations.
Secure Boot Compatibility and Requirements
Before enabling Secure Boot, it's essential to verify if your hardware supports this feature. Most modern computers with UEFI firmware do, but older systems may not. Additionally, your operating system must be Secure Boot compatible. This includes Windows 10, Windows 11, and many distributions of Linux. When configuring Secure Boot, you might consider updating your firmware to make sure you have the latest security features.

How to Enable Secure Boot in BIOS/UEFI
The following sections provide clear, step-by-step instructions on how to enable Secure Boot on both Windows and Linux systems. Enabling Secure Boot typically occurs through the BIOS or UEFI settings, and while the exact steps may differ based on the manufacturer, the core processes remain largely the same.
Accessing BIOS/UEFI Settings
To enable Secure Boot, begin by accessing your computer's BIOS/UEFI settings. Restart your system and press the appropriate key during the initial boot process; commonly, this may be F2, Del, Esc, or F10 (varies by manufacturer). Once inside, navigate to the Boot or Security tab where you will find the Secure Boot options.
Configuring Secure Boot Options
Once you have located the Secure Boot menu, you will typically see an option to enable or disable Secure Boot. Change the setting to “Enabled.” If there’s an option for a Secure Boot mode (Standard or Custom), select Standard for the best results. It’s also vital to ensure that the `CSM` (Compatibility Support Module) is disabled, as this can prevent Secure Boot from functioning correctly.
Saving and Exiting BIOS/UEFI
After configuring the Secure Boot options, make sure to save your changes before exiting. Most BIOS/UEFI interfaces will prompt you to confirm when you attempt to exit with unsaved changes. Remember to boot into your operating system after making these changes to ensure Secure Boot is functioning as intended.
Troubleshooting Secure Boot Issues
After enabling Secure Boot, users may encounter various issues ranging from boot failures to operating system errors. Understanding common troubleshooting steps can aid in quickly resolving these concerns.
Common Secure Boot Errors
One prevalent issue is the “Secure Boot Violation” error, which occurs when the system detects unauthorized software or operating system files. This can commonly happen after an OS update or if you've recently installed any unsigned drivers. If this occurs, you may need to either disable Secure Boot momentarily or enroll the proper keys for your software.
Verifying Secure Boot Status
To ensure that Secure Boot is functioning correctly, you can check the status within your operating system. In Windows, you can access this by running msinfo32 in the search bar and checking the Secure Boot State under the System Summary. If the state reads “On,” your Secure Boot is active.
Addressing Compatibility Issues
If you find that certain applications or hardware incompatible with Secure Boot, consider reaching out to technical support from the manufacturer. Sometimes, firmware updates may resolve compatibility issues. Furthermore, managing Secure Boot keys may help in allowing previously untrusted applications to run.
Best Practices for Managing Secure Boot Settings
To maintain a secure and efficient system, it’s important to follow best practices for managing Secure Boot settings effectively.
Regular Firmware Updates
Keeping your firmware updated is crucial as manufacturers continuously improve security features and compatibility with hardware and software. Enable automatic updates wherever possible or regularly check the manufacturer's website for updates.
Secure Boot Key Management
Understanding how to manage Secure Boot keys can enhance security substantially. Users should familiarize themselves with public key infrastructure (PKI) concepts to control which UEFI applications can be trusted during boot sequences. You can set custom signatures for your applications, enhancing system integrity and resilience against malware and unauthorized access.
Assessing Secure Boot Policies
Establish robust policies concerning who has permission to modify Secure Boot settings. Only trusted and trained personnel should have access to these settings, minimizing the chances of unqualified configurations being executed. Similarly, conducting periodic security audits can fortify your understanding and arm against impending threats.
Conclusion
In conclusion, enabling Secure Boot is a pivotal step in securing your system against evolving cyber threats. By following the comprehensive instructions on how to enable Secure Boot and mastering its configurations, you can significantly improve your system's defenses. Remember to keep your system and firmware updated regularly while managing keys effectively to leverage the full benefits of Secure Boot. Adopting Secure Boot as a standard practice can help ensure your digital assets remain secure in 2025 and beyond.
For more related topics, visit this guide or explore this resource.